Artieos, Oakeys Choice and Rained Out to take up the running at a decent tempo. MAN FROM BRUSSELLS (4) was saved for this and has been busting to break through for his third win. Finds easier than Dubbo the latest and 2x winning rider Mathew Cahill is reunited. That's a decent push for his chances. PUSHALOT (2) has also been threatening and Owen sticks with the Canberra-trained galloper on a 9-day return. Will go forward and is a live chance. ANTHRACIA (3) was a winner over 1000m at this track last time out, coming home well to score by a nose. Draws inside and will be tough to stop again. ARTIEOS (1) resumes and has won twice fresh. Has trialled well at Moruya and is a betting watch. OAKEYS CHOICE (5) tumbles in weight this grade with a 3kg claim atop and will push forward. Keep onside. SUGGESTED PLAY: Going with Man From Brussells.
